Registered Wiring Technician (CWS)
A Certified Wiring Specialist (CWS) is a highly skilled professional who has demonstrated expertise in the installation, maintenance, and repair of electrical wiring systems. To earn the CWS certification, individuals must pass a rigorous examination covering topics such as Industry Standards, wire specifications, circuit implementation, and troubleshooting methods.
CWS-certified electricians are essential to ensuring the safety and reliability of electrical installations in residential, commercial, and industrial settings. Their knowledge of complex wiring systems helps prevent electrical hazards and guarantee compliance with industry regulations.
- Duties of a CWS may encompass:
- Reading and interpreting electrical schematics
- Installing various types of wiring, including conduit
- Troubleshooting and repairing wiring issues
- Performing safety inspections|Conducting electrical safety audits
